CVE-2022-47598: WordPress WP Super Popup Plugin <= 1.1.2 is vulnerable to Cross Site Scripting (XSS)

Auth. (admin+) St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in WP Plugins Pro WP Super Popup plugin <= 1.1.2 versions.

Plain-English summary

WP Super Popup for WordPress is reported vulnerable to stored cross-site scripting through version 1.1.2. An already-privileged administrator-level user could store script content that later runs in another user's browser. This is not a broad unauthenticated takeover issue, but it can still matter on shared, delegated, or compromised WordPress admin environments.

Executive priority

Handle during normal vulnerability management unless the plugin is installed on externally important sites or administrator accounts are weakly governed. Prioritize confirmation of exposure, privileged-account hygiene, and vendor guidance before treating this as an emergency.

Technical view

CVE-2022-47598 is a CWE-79 stored XSS issue in WP Plugins Pro WP Super Popup <= 1.1.2. The CVSS 3.1 score is 5.9 with network access, low complexity, high privileges required, user interaction required, and changed scope. The source bundle does not name a fixed version or vendor remediation.

Likely exposure

Exposure is limited to WordPress sites using the WP Super Popup plugin at version 1.1.2 or earlier. Risk is higher where many users have administrator-level WordPress access, admin accounts are shared, or admin compromise is already plausible.

Exploitation context

The provided sources do not show CISA KEV listing or active exploitation. The vulnerability requires authenticated admin-level privileges and user interaction, which reduces mass exploitation likelihood but still permits persistent browser-side impact after privileged access is obtained.

Researcher notes

The record identifies WP Plugins Pro WP Super Popup <= 1.1.2 and CWE-79, but affected-version metadata is sparse and no patch version is stated in the source bundle. Treat remediation details as incomplete and avoid assuming exploit availability without additional evidence.

Mitigation direction

  • Inventory WordPress sites for the wp-super-popup plugin.
  • Check whether any installed version is 1.1.2 or earlier.
  • Consult vendor, WordPress, or Patchstack guidance for a fixed release.
  • Disable or remove affected installations if no safe update is available.
  • Limit administrator access to trusted, named accounts only.
  • Review recent plugin configuration changes by administrator users.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m plugin presence and version from WordPress administration or asset inventory.
  • Verify whether the instance is running version 1.1.2 or earlier.
  • Review administrator account list for shared or unnecessary privileged users.
  • Inspect recent popup content changes for unexpected script-like content.
  • Check security logs for suspicious administrator sessions or configuration edits.
